Configuration Management Specialist Temp



Job description

General Atomics (GA), and its affiliated companies, is one of the world’s leading resources for high-technology systems development ranging from the nuclear fuel cycle to remotely piloted aircraft, airborne sensors, and advanced electric, electronic, wireless and laser technologies.

General Atomics Electromagnetic Systems (GA-EMS) designs and manufactures first-of-a-kind electromagnetic and electric power generation systems.

GA-EMS’ expanding portfolio of specialized products and integrated system solutions support critical fleet, space systems and satellites, missile defense, power and energy, and process and monitoring applications for defense, industrial, and commercial customers worldwide.

Under general supervision, this position coordinates and administers assigned configuration management activities relative to identification, control, and accounting for systems and/or equipment in accordance with contractual requirements.

Monitors procedures for assigned organization and recommends changes to engineering documents for assigned programs.

Develops solutions to a variety of problems of moderate scope and complexity.

Reviews released engineering change data and coordinates changes with engineering, quality, support, manufacturing, and engineering data control activities.

Ensures change accounting activity is in compliance with configuration management policies.

**D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ES:**

+ Administers configuration management activities related to identification, control and accounting for engineering documents, parts and BOMS for systems and/or equipment in accordance with contractual requirements.
+ Maintains procedures to implement and process engineering documents for all assigned projects to ensure compliance with policies and scheduling requirements.
+ Participates in reviewing engineering change data and coordinates changes with engineering, quality assurance and manufacturing to ensure compliance with customer requirements and Company policy.
+ Reviews work project notifications to assure the accuracy of current contractual reporting requirements.
+ Maintains procedures for storage, retention and destruction of company records, processing, filming, storing and retrieving current and historical design, technical and programmatic documents according to project, customer and company practices and requirements.
+ May participate in change control meetings.

**Job Qualifications:**

+ Typically requires a bachelor's degree in business administration, engineering or a related discipline and six or more years of progressive government or commercial configuration management experience.

Equivalent professional government or commercial configuration management experience may be substituted in lieu of education.
+ Must have a general understanding of configuration management concepts and principles, related governmental rules and regulations and experience demonstrating a general application of those concepts and principles
+ Ability to participate in the development of new CDM concepts and communicate and apply them accurately throughout an evolving environment;
+ Experience using PLM tool, Windchill experience desired;
+ Knowledge of the 5 elements of Configuration Management;
+ Familiarization with parts and bills-of-materials;
+ Knowledge of material dispositions and effectivities for proposed changes;
+ Ability to support verification and auditing, and status accounting activities;
+ Organization skills to coordinate work phases;
+ Ability to determine the appropriate approach at the task or project level and provide solutions to moderately complex proposal problems;
+ Good communication, documentation, presentation and interpersonal skills to effectively interact with all levels of employees and management;
+ Ability to represent the organization on proposal matters with external customers.

Ability to work independently or in a team environment is essential as is the ability to work extended hours and travel as required.

**Salary:** $73,700 - $128,780 **Travel Percentage Required** 0 - 25 **Relocation Assistance Provided** Not Provided **US Citizenship Required?** Yes **Clearance Required?** Desired **Clearance Level** Mid-Level (3-7 years) **Workstyle** Onsite
